Central Election Commission receives documents of applicants for post of President

On Saturday, September 5, the Central Election Commission of Belarus received documents of applicants for the post of the President. Four potential candidates reached the stage of registration. This became known after publication of the results of verification of signature sheets.

Thus, in support of Alexander Lukashenko more than 1 700 000 valid signatures have been collected, more than 7.5 thousand signatures have not stood the test. Nikolai Ulakhovich collected almost 150 thousand signatures. Almost 10 thousand signatures were not valid. Sergei Haidukevich collected nearly 140 thousand valid signature sheets. About 2 thousand signatures were not reliable. Tatiana Karatkevich managed to collect more than 100,000 signatures. 2000 signatures were unreliable.

Viktor Tereshchenko had the biggest number of violations. From 130 thousand submitted signature sheets only 6500 were valid. It means that more than 120 thousand signatures were invalid.
